well, i got videos of before and after the thrush resonator replacement, but you can't really tell if there is a difference. i took them fromt he same distance, but they are both so close that the mic on the camera doesnt pick the sound up that good. i'll get a better video later. personally i think it's a bit quieter, and the day after i replaced it my boss who is always joking about how loud my car was asked me if i fixed the exhaust without me saying anything about having messed with it.
interesting note though, the stock resonator on my exhaust was in fact perforated, it was only about half the size of my thrush though. plus the thrush is so cheap that i think it is definitely worth it to try in your case. total spent on my 2.5"exhaust+header+thrush comes out to around 250 total, and i think it sounds pretty good.
